    ComNet23 Jones Award Keynote: Whistleblower Aid

    ComNet23 Jones Award Keynote: Whistleblower Aid

    Whistleblower Aid has been named the sixth winner of the Clarence B. Jones Impact Award, an honor from The Communications Network that recognizes and celebrates the impact of transformative communications campaigns in the social sector. They join Truth Initiative, Florida Rights Restoration Coalition, A Step Ahead Chattanooga, United We Dream, and Innocence Project as #JonesAward recipients for their work to empower whistleblowers and shift public narratives in favor of accountability.

    ComNet22 The Comms Long Game: How The USWNT Won Their Fight For Equal Pay

    ComNet22 The Comms Long Game: How The USWNT Won Their Fight For Equal Pay

    Join us for a keynote conversation focused on communications lessons learned from the US Women’s National Soccer team’s landmark effort to achieve equal pay. The team’s work made clear how plain communications can be a powerful tool to create impact by building broad alliances and reshaping culture — and consequently, policy; as well as the need for patience and persistence — because communications change work is a long game.
